Details

Features

  • Looks and sounds like the real thing; handle plays fun flushing sounds and personal reward message to reward child for each success
  • A sensor plays a greeting when child sits on potty, and plays a congratulatory greeting and song when child makes a deposit, to reinforce success
  • Trainer seat removes to fit adult toilet to ease transition
  • Assembly required; made of plastic; recommended for children over 18 mos., up to 50 lbs.
  • 13.5Hx12.5Wx11.15D"

Fun idea, but distracts from purpose... June 12, 2007 Reviewer:  Jennifer M. Shell Real Name (Oak Ridge, TN)  See all my reviews >

I just purchased the Safety 1st Smart Rewards Potty for my son (3 yrs). He's most definitely interested in potty training and shows all the "signs" of wanting to learn, so I thought getting him his own potty would be a good way to move the process along.

This potty is cute, small enough that he can sit on it and "do it all by himself," and it plays all kinds of cute greetings and encouragements. The problem, I'm finding, is that after it plays it's greeting, "Hi there, big kid! Welcome back! etc..." it plays a little elevator music (as I refer to it) until he goes. My son seems to prefer sitting there listening to the music rather than doing what I KNOW he needs to do. All the "fun" features seem to be a distration from the purpose, rather than the encouragement they're supposed to be.

He does, however, LOVE the star sticker reward system - though it takes him forever to do anything to deserve the reward.

We've only had it for about 5 days, though, and so things might change once we've established more of a routine and he gets used to it.

Just Not For Us September 25, 2008 Reviewer:  L. A. Fiore Real Name (Wynnewood, PA)  See all my reviews >

This potty is really cute and I thought it would be a great alternative to the plain potties my daughters trained on, but the noises, the speaking, all of it terrified my son! Apparently not all kids want their toilet to talk to them :) Also, the seat and base are very narrow and not as sturdy as some wider based potties.
